Shooting in Chicago: 49-year-old man shot, 21-year-old man injured in Austin on North Leamington Avenue, police say

CHICAGO (WLS) — On Friday evening, two men were shot on the west side of the city, one of them fatally.

Chicago police said officers responded to an alarm using gunshot detection technology in the 700 block of North Leamington Avenue in the Austin neighborhood at around 4:55 p.m.

Two victims were found at the scene. A 49-year-old man had a gunshot wound to the head and a 21-year-old man had a gunshot wound to the leg, police said.

The 49-year-old victim was taken to Mt. Sinai Hospital and was initially reported to be in critical condition. He was later pronounced dead.

The younger victim was also taken to Mount Sinai and is said to be in stable condition.

While the Chicago Police Department's investigation continues, no one has been arrested.

Further information was not initially available.
